    **Flight Sensor Operator (FSO)** is an individual gathering information from a flying airborne platform (manned or unmanned). The FSO is a crewmember when participating in any flight activity.

     

    The primary responsibilities of a Flight Sensor Operator are to ensure the safe operation of the Sensor systems in conjunction with the flight, effectively operate assigned remote sensing systems and support the processing, exploitation, and dissemination of collected information.

    Some of the general duties of a Flight Sensor Operator are:

    + Flight Crewmember when assigned to flights

    + Participation and contribution to our Safety Management System

    + Sensor flight planning

    + Participating in Crew Resource Management

    + Sensor Operations

    + Manage, analyze, and distribute acquired data effectively

    + Sensor installation, testing & maintenance

    + Collection management

    + Quality Control (QC) of acquired data

     

    Learn and apply complex principles of aerial photography, videography, LiDAR, airborne GPS, and inertial navigation systems.
